The investigation into a shipwreck that left seven people dead is focused on determining the cause of the tragic incident. The investigators are exploring different possibilities, including extreme weather conditions, potential human error, or problems with the yacht itself. The main goal of the investigation is to identify the factors that contributed to the shipwreck and to prevent similar accidents from happening in the future.

Extreme weather conditions are one of the potential factors that could have played a role in the shipwreck. Investigators are looking into the weather conditions at the time of the incident, including wind speed, sea conditions, and any other weather-related factors that may have contributed to the shipwreck. Extreme weather can pose a significant risk to vessels at sea, and it is important to understand how weather conditions may have impacted the safety of the yacht.

Human error is another possible factor that the investigators are considering as they search for answers about the shipwreck. It is important to determine whether any mistakes were made by the crew or passengers that may have led to the accident. The investigators will review the actions of the crew and passengers leading up to the shipwreck to determine if any errors were made that could have been avoided.

In addition to extreme weather conditions and human error, problems with the yacht itself are also being examined as part of the investigation. Investigators will assess the condition of the yacht, including its maintenance history, any previous incidents, and the overall seaworthiness of the vessel. Problems with the yacht, such as mechanical failures or structural issues, could have contributed to the shipwreck and will be thoroughly investigated.
